Self-regulating Tool Rotation CNC Routers

To significantly boost productivity and reduce operator involvement, many modern CNC machines now feature automatic tool exchange (ATC) systems. These advanced mechanisms allow the router to quickly switch between multiple cutters without requiring manual participation. This not only minimizes downtime between tasks but also enables the creation of complex pieces utilizing a wider range of shapes. Some sophisticated systems even incorporate workpiece platforms, capable of holding a considerable quantity of bits and further streamlining the fabrication process. The investment in an ATC CNC mill often yields a considerable return through lowered labor costs and increased volume.
